What is the process for declaring marriage annulment due to impotence in Argentina?

The declaration of marriage annulment due to impotence in Argentina is requested through a judicial process. Evidence must be presented to demonstrate the existence of impotence at the time of marriage and the impossibility of having a normal sexual life. The court will evaluate the situation and, if the requirements are met, will declare the marriage null and void.

What is legal capacity in Mexican civil law?

Legal capacity is the ability of people to be holders of rights and obligations, as well as to exercise them themselves.

What are the investment options for people with low incomes in Chile?

Even if income is low, there are investment options accessible to people in Chile. Some alternatives include savings accounts at financial institutions, mutual funds with low minimum investment amounts, time deposits, and state savings programs, such as the Esperanza Fund. Additionally, systematic long-term savings, even in small amounts, can generate significant growth. It is important to seek financial advice and evaluate the options available to start a savings and investment plan appropriate to your possibilities.

What is bad faith possession in Mexican civil law?

Possession in bad faith occurs when the possessor knows that he does not have the right to possess the thing, but still possesses it.

What are the sanctions that the Superintendency of Insurance and Reinsurance of Panama can apply in cases of violations by insurance companies?

The Superintendency of Insurance and Reinsurance of Panama can apply various sanctions in cases of violations by insurance companies. These sanctions may include fines, temporary or permanent suspensions of operations, revocation of licenses and other corrective measures. The imposition of sanctions aims to maintain the solidity and transparency of the insurance sector, protect policyholders and guarantee compliance with regulations in the insurance field in Panama.
